A rollback is recommended: the gsan was not shut down cleanly. (This affect the actual state of the VM's?)

$
0
0

Hi, i have vSphere Data Protection 5.1, but trying to start services i receive this message. If i Roll back to the most recent checkpoint, it affects the actual state of the vmachines?

Or it just roll backs the Data Protection system?

 

root@vmwarebkp:/dev/#: dpnctl start all

Identity added: /home/dpn/.ssh/dpnid (/home/dpn/.ssh/dpnid)

dpnctl: INFO: Checking that gsan was shut down cleanly...

  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-  -

Here are the most recent validated and non-validated checkpoints:

  Fri Aug 21 16:00:23 2015 UTC Validated(type=rolling)

  Fri Aug 21 16:05:58 2015 UTC Not Validated

 

A rollback is recommended: the gsan was not shut down cleanly.

 

The choices are as follows:

  1   roll back to the most recent checkpoint, whether or not validated

  2   roll back to the most recent validated checkpoint

  3   select a specific checkpoint to which to roll back

  4   restart, but do not roll back (NOT RECOMMENDED:

                                     gsan reported unclean shutdown)
